Documentation/filesystems/debugfs.txt:
"""
Once upon a time, debugfs users were required to remember the dentry pointer
for every debugfs file they created so that all files could be cleaned up.
We live in more civilized times now, though, and debugfs users can call:

    void debugfs_remove_recursive(struct dentry *dentry);
"""
